Course # 30562 Section Number 1 Day(s) Th Time(s) 2:00pm-4:50pm Term Fall 2023 Course Instructor Brooke Fox Syllabus Syllabus 9/1/23 This course will teach students how to create a well-crafted data visualization that can tell a story or communicate an idea in an instant. In this course, students will learn data mining, chart construction, and most importantly, they will learn strategies for communicating a complex concept with a single image. Formerly called Chart Communications: Telling Stories with Data Visualization.
